欢迎来到天天文库
浏览记录
ID:12878206
大小:39.50 KB
页数:9页
时间:2018-07-19
《基于云计算的bi系统混合架构研究》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、基于云计算的BI系统混合架构研究【摘要】随着中国移动用户数、业务的迅猛发展和市场竞争的加剧,bi系统要能具备实时和非实时、结构化和非结构化、低成本等特性。文章在分析了传统数据仓库技术在支持bi系统新特性上遇到的难题之后,提出了基于云计算的bi系统混合架构,对其中的云硬件架构与云软件架构中用到的关键技术作了研究。【关键词】bi 数据仓库 虚拟化 分布式计算 share—nothing 列存储引言中国移动从2002年开始着手建设bi系统(移动内部简称“经营分析系统”基于云计算的BI系统混合架构研究【摘要】随
2、着中国移动用户数、业务的迅猛发展和市场竞争的加剧,bi系统要能具备实时和非实时、结构化和非结构化、低成本等特性。文章在分析了传统数据仓库技术在支持bi系统新特性上遇到的难题之后,提出了基于云计算的bi系统混合架构,对其中的云硬件架构与云软件架构中用到的关键技术作了研究。【关键词】bi 数据仓库 虚拟化 分布式计算 share—nothing 列存储引言中国移动从2002年开始着手建设bi系统(移动内部简称“经营分析系统”基于云计算的BI系统混合架构研究【摘要】随着中国移动用户数、业务的迅猛发展和市场竞争
3、的加剧,bi系统要能具备实时和非实时、结构化和非结构化、低成本等特性。文章在分析了传统数据仓库技术在支持bi系统新特性上遇到的难题之后,提出了基于云计算的bi系统混合架构,对其中的云硬件架构与云软件架构中用到的关键技术作了研究。【关键词】bi 数据仓库 虚拟化 分布式计算 share—nothing 列存储引言中国移动从2002年开始着手建设bi系统(移动内部简称“经营分析系统”),该系统是以客户为中心,面向企业内部各层面对象,将企业决策支持、市场经营分析和一线营销服务支撑作为服务目标,以数据仓库为基础
4、数据平台的智能支撑信息系统。从技术上讲,该系统涉及到数据仓库、联机分析处理、数据挖掘、人工智能和统计学等多种学科与技术的交叉。其中,数据仓库技术为bi系统核心技术。在bi系统十年的建设过程中,随着中国移动用户数、业务的迅猛发展和市场竞争的加剧,公司决策人员、市场经营分析人员和一线生产人员对bi系统需求越来越多,要求也越来越高。传统数据仓库技术在满足现在的bi系统架构设计、工程实施方面,遇到了一系列难题:(1)数据持续爆炸性增长,系统处理的数据量越来越大,架构设计上传统的隔夜批量处理已无法支撑,进而要求系
5、统支持准实时方式处理。如话单数据的处理,要求每15分钟甚至更短时间就必须处理一次;对于信令数据来说,处理周期要求更短;(2)随着业务的多样化,在支持传统结构化数据之外,要求能支持非结构化和半结构化数据,非结构化数据如视频数据、图像数据和文档数据等,半结构化如xml数据;(3)对于混合的数据负载和用户多变的访问方式,同一份表需要适应不同应用负载需要,如话单表除满足大数据量装载需求,还要满足后续的汇总处理以及业务人员的前台在线查询等需求;(4)成本增长太快,扩容压力加大。数据仓库采用小型机+磁盘阵列的方式,
6、构建在高端硬件平台上,高性能带来了高成本。同时未将数据处理功能和数据存储功能分散考虑,导致架构单一,扩容时需要综合考虑处理性能和磁盘容量并取最大值。这一系列难题所带来的问题,就是单一的数据仓库架构无法灵活满足各类需求。云计算架构体系作为一种新兴的共享基础架构方法,虽然各方表述不太一样,但从技术上讲,其本质都是通过将企业计算动态分布到集群计算机上,根据业务发展和应用使用情况对软硬件资源进行灵活的调配,以实现按需访问,对内对外提供各种应用服务。云计算其主要特性包括虚拟化和多租户、自动部署和统一管理、低成本海
7、量存储能力、大规模横向扩展,而这些特性正好能解决传统数据仓库技术所不能解决的问题。为适应市场对bi系统的新需求,本文旨在研究如何构建云计算环境下的新一代bi系统混合架构,从而更有效地为企业领导决策支持、市场经营分析和一线营销服务。2基于云计算的bi混合架构2.1bi混合架构针对以上变化,本文在传统bi系统数据仓库架构基础上,结合云计算新特性,综合虚拟化、分布式文件系统、soa等技术,提出了新的基于云计算环境下的bi昆合架构。其架构如图1所示:基于云计算的bi系统混合架构由云硬件架构、云软件架构、云应用架
8、构和云管理架构组成,每层结构分述如下:(1)云硬件架构,其重点为基础设施建设,使用虚拟化技术,将物理服务器、存储和网络组成虚拟集群,以供上层软件平台调用;(2)云软件架构,由数据中心、服务中心和访问中心组成;◆数据中心,作为整个系统架构的核心,根据企业内部应用的特点,进行统一数据建模。该中心存储了整个企业的全部数据,不仅包含基础数据,而且也包括经过不同应用深加工后的信息数据。数据中心可根据不同的应用计算方式,混合采用分布式文件系统、内存数据
此文档下载收益归作者所有